Accident occurred Saturday, August 02, 1986 in HUGOTON, KS
Aircraft: CESSNA 188B, registration: N9379G
Injuries: 1 Uninjured.
NTSB investigators may not have traveled in support of this investigation and used data provided by various sources to prepare this aircraft accident report.THE PIC STATED THAT HE WAS FLYING LOW AND SLOW IN AN ATTEMPT TO OBSERVE AN ACFT THAT HAD JUST CRASHED IN AN OPEN FLD OFF THE DEPARTURE END OF THE RWY AT HUGOTON. THE ACFT WAS THEN OBSERVED TO ROLL LEFT AND DESCEND AND IMPACT THE GND ABOUT 1/4 MILE BEYOND WHERE THE ALREADY DOWNED AG ACFT WAS SPOTTED. THE PIC STATED HE HAD NO MECHANICAL PBLM WITH THE ACFT DURING ANY PART OF THIS DEPARTURE.
The National Transportation Safety Board determines the probable cause(s) of this accident to be:
STALL..INADVERTENT..PILOT IN COMMAND
Contributing Factors
TERRAIN CONDITION..OPEN FIELD
Contributing Factors
DIVERTED ATTENTION..PILOT IN COMMAND
